Ordinals
testnet
Sat 1363501541738336
decimal
335400.1541738336
degree
0°125400′744″1541738336‴
percentile
64.9286449161042%
name
eepuqyublxp
cycle
0
epoch
1
period
166
block
335400
offset
1541738336
timestamp
2015-04-13 17:59:17 UTC
rarity
common
prev
next